Output 7ec590f7125afb44a63b82a6941c17f1f3c191fd8fefb5e55332f61953e45ca3:0

value
18340
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 abf17dbf85d5d6f851c352953bfa4c7286e33c2df56cd52bdd1e17f338456e3f
address
ltc1p40chm0u96ht0s5wr222nh7jvw2rwx0pd74kd227arctlxwz9dclsk33auv
transaction
7ec590f7125afb44a63b82a6941c17f1f3c191fd8fefb5e55332f61953e45ca3
spent
true